Provided is a multi-level parking lot for a motorcycle that quickly and surely aligns a fall prevention device with respect to a steering wheel of a motorcycle and reliably prevents a fall due to an unintentional fall or an external force such as an earthquake.
A motorcycle multilevel parking garage for parking a motorcycle B, wherein a support bar 1 is provided so as to be movable up and down with respect to a floor surface 2 and an end 3a is attached to a tip of the support bar. A motorcycle overturn prevention device 6 having a string-like member 3 and a locking tool 5 that is provided at a distal end portion 3b on the other end side of the string-like member and locks a handle 4 on one side of the bike B is provided. 本考案はバイク用立体駐車場に関し、バイクのハンドルに対する転倒防止装置の位置合わせを迅速かつ確実に行い、不用意な転倒や地震等の外力に対する転倒を確実に防止しようとするものである。   The present invention relates to a three-dimensional parking lot for a motorcycle, and is intended to quickly and surely align the fall prevention device with respect to the handle of the motorcycle, and to prevent accidental fall or fall due to an external force such as an earthquake.

従来、バイク、スクータ等の二輪車輌を駐車させるための駐車装置としては、駐輪スペースを無駄がなく駐輪し、また、駐輪させたバイク等の二輪車輌が不用意に転倒したり、地震等による外力により転倒するのを防止するという安全性を考慮して、例えば床面と略平行に横設された案内軌条に沿って移動可能に設けられた台車に支持腕を取り付け、該支持腕の先端部に二輪車両のハンドルのハンドルグリップを捕捉し得るグリップ捕捉部を取り付けて成り、且つ支持腕とグリップ捕捉部との組が全体として台車に対して少なくとも前後方向に傾斜自在であると共に、グリップ捕捉部が支持腕周りに回転自在に設けられているものがあった。この駐車装置は、二輪車輌のハンドルのグリップを捕捉具によって捕捉するのに、駐車させる二輪車輌の前輪車をこの位置まで進入させ、操作グリップを操って、正副の支持杆の前後方向の傾斜角度、この軸回りの回転角度や軸方向への伸縮距離の調節を行いつつ、ハンドルのグリップを捕捉具に挿入して捕捉するものであった(例えば特許文献1参照。)。
実用新案登録第2510891号公報
Conventionally, as a parking device for parking motorcycles, scooters and the like motorcycles, the parking space is parked without waste, and motorcycles such as motorcycles that have been parked accidentally fall down or earthquakes occur. Considering the safety of preventing falling due to external force due to, etc., for example, a support arm is attached to a carriage that is movably provided along a guide rail that is laid substantially parallel to the floor surface. A grip capturing part that can capture the handle grip of the handle of a two-wheeled vehicle is attached to the tip of the two-wheeled vehicle, and the set of the support arm and the grip capturing part as a whole is tiltable at least in the front-rear direction with respect to the carriage, Some grip capturing portions are provided so as to be rotatable around the supporting arm. In this parking device, in order to capture the grip of the handle of the two-wheeled vehicle with the catching device, the front wheel of the two-wheeled vehicle to be parked is advanced to this position, and the operation grip is manipulated to tilt the front and rear support rods in the front-rear direction. The grip of the handle is inserted and captured while adjusting the rotation angle around the axis and the expansion / contraction distance in the axial direction (see, for example, Patent Document 1).
Utility Model Registration No. 2510891

しかしながら、特許文献1に記載の上記従来の二輪車輌を駐車させるための駐車装置は、ハンドルのグリップを捕捉具によって捕捉するのに、捕捉具に対するハンドルの取付位置での位置合わせは、床面と略平行に横設された案内軌条に沿って台車を移動させたり、正副の支持杆の前後方向の傾斜角度の調整を行ったり、軸回りの回転角度の調整を行ったり、軸方向への伸縮距離の調節等に数操作が必要になり、多くの手間および時間がかかり、取扱い操作が面倒であった。   However, in the parking apparatus for parking the conventional two-wheeled vehicle described in Patent Document 1, the grip of the handle is captured by the capturing tool. Move the carriage along the guide rails installed in parallel, adjust the tilt angle of the front and rear support rods in the front-rear direction, adjust the rotation angle around the axis, expand and contract in the axial direction Several operations are required to adjust the distance, which takes a lot of labor and time, and the handling operation is troublesome.

また、特許文献1に記載の上記従来の二輪車輌を駐車させるための駐車装置では、構造が複雑で、部品点数も多く、製作および組付けが容易でなく、製作コストは高価であった。   Moreover, the parking device for parking the above-described conventional two-wheeled vehicle described in Patent Document 1 has a complicated structure, a large number of parts, is difficult to manufacture and assemble, and is expensive to manufacture.

本考案は上記従来の欠点を解決し、バイクのハンドルに対する転倒防止装置の位置合わせが迅速かつ確実に行え、また、構造簡単にして製作および組み付けが容易であり、さらには部品点数が少なく、製作コストが安価なバイク用立体駐車場を提供することを目的とする。   The present invention solves the above-mentioned conventional drawbacks, allows the quick and reliable positioning of the fall prevention device with respect to the handle of the motorcycle, makes the structure simple and easy to manufacture and assemble, and further reduces the number of parts and manufacture. The object is to provide a three-dimensional parking lot for motorcycles at low cost.

本実施形態は、バイクBを駐輪するバイク用立体駐車場であって、床面2に対し上下前後に移動可能に設けられた支持棒1と、該支持棒1の先端に一端3aが取付けられた紐状部材3と、該紐状部材3の他端側の先端部3bに設けられてバイクBの一側のハンドル4を係止する係止具5と、を有するバイク転倒防止装置6を備えている。   The present embodiment is a three-dimensional parking lot for a motorcycle that parks a motorcycle B, and is provided with a support bar 1 that can be moved up and down with respect to the floor 2, and one end 3 a attached to the tip of the support bar 1. A motorcycle overturn prevention device 6 having a cord-like member 3 and a locking tool 5 that is provided at a tip 3b on the other end side of the cord-like member 3 and latches a handle 4 on one side of the motorcycle B. It has.

前記バイク転倒防止装置6は、少なくともバイクBの前部、および左右の両側には、前記バイクBを囲むように、転倒防止柵7A,7B,7B′が設けられている。このうち、左右の両側の前記転倒防止柵7B,7B′相互間の略1/2の設置幅Wが、バイクBの中立姿勢におけるハンドル4,4の設置高さhに相当する長さLよりも短く形成されている。このように、左右の両側の前記転倒防止柵7B,7B′相互間の略1/2の設置幅Wが、バイクBの中立姿勢におけるハンドル4,4の設置高さhに相当する長さLよりも短く形成したのは、スタンドSにて支持されるバイクBは、床面2に対し上下前後に移動可能に設けられた支持棒1の先端に一端3aが取付けられた紐状部材3の他端側の先端部3bに設けられた係止具5により紐状部材3を介して一側のハンドル4が係止されて駐輪されているバイクBが、仮に紐状部材3が地震等により切断されることがあっても不用意に転倒したり、または地震等による外力により転倒するのを防止し、安全性を高くするためである。   The motorcycle overturn prevention device 6 is provided with fall prevention fences 7A, 7B, 7B 'so as to surround the motorcycle B at least at the front part of the motorcycle B and on both the left and right sides. Among these, the installation width W between the left and right sides of the fall prevention fences 7B and 7B 'is approximately ½ of the length L corresponding to the installation height h of the handles 4 and 4 in the neutral position of the motorcycle B. Is also formed short. Thus, a length L corresponding to the installation height h of the handles 4 and 4 in the neutral position of the motorcycle B is a width ½ of the installation width W between the left and right fall prevention fences 7B and 7B ′. The bike B supported by the stand S is formed of a cord-like member 3 in which one end 3a is attached to the tip of a support bar 1 provided so as to be movable up and down with respect to the floor 2. The motorcycle B in which the handle 4 on one side is locked by the locking member 5 provided at the tip 3b on the other end side via the string-like member 3 is parked. This is to prevent accidental falling or falling by an external force due to an earthquake or the like even if it is cut due to, thereby increasing safety.

前記支持棒1を上下前後に移動可能に設けるには、本実施形態では、図2乃至図4に図示するように、左側に設けた転倒防止柵7Bの横柵8,8に前後方向Yに摺動可能に外嵌された案内枠体9,9′と、該案内枠体9を横柵8の所望位置に取り付ける止めボルト10A、およびナット10Bと、前記案内枠体9,9′の外側に縦に固着される支持外筒体11と、該支持外筒体11内に上下方向Zに摺動自在に挿入される前記支持棒1と、該支持棒1を前記支持外筒体11の所望位置に取り付けるセットピン12、および該セットピン12の雄ねじ部12aに螺合される雌ねじ孔13aを有する操作ノブ13とにより形成される。   In order to provide the support rod 1 so as to be movable up and down, in the present embodiment, as shown in FIGS. 2 to 4, in the front-rear direction Y on the side fences 8 and 8 of the fall prevention fence 7B provided on the left side. Guide frame bodies 9 and 9 'fitted to be slidable, set bolts 10A and nuts 10B for attaching the guide frame bodies 9 to desired positions of the lateral fence 8, and outside the guide frame bodies 9 and 9' A support outer cylinder 11 that is vertically fixed to the support outer cylinder 11, the support rod 1 that is slidably inserted in the vertical direction Z into the support outer cylinder 11, and the support rod 1 of the support outer cylinder 11 The set pin 12 is attached to a desired position, and the operation knob 13 has a female screw hole 13a screwed into the male screw portion 12a of the set pin 12.

前記係止具5が、紐状部材3の自由端側が一方のハンドル4に掛け回された後に所定位置にて係止されるものであれば如何様なものでも良いが、本実施形態では例えば図5に示すように、前記係止具5が、前後に配する第1ピン体P1、および第2ピン体P2により対向された側壁部14A,14Aを有する基枠部14と、前記側壁部14A,14A間の略中程に回動軸15により起倒可能に枢着され、先端側の周面にはカム面16aが設けられ、前記回動軸15に捲回されたねじりばね17により常時、閉方向イに附勢されているレバー式の挟持部材16と、により構成される。そして、一端3aが固定されるとともに中途が前記第1ピン体P1に止着された前記紐状部材3の自由端側は、前記ハンドル4に掛け回されて前記カム16a面と、前記第2ピン体P2との間に挟持可能に挿通して引き締め力を加えることにより、常時、ねじりばね17の附勢力により閉方向イに附勢されている挟持部材16の前記カム面16aと第2ピン体P2とにより紐状部材3は挟持され、係止具5にて係止される。また、ねじりばね17の附勢力に抗して回動軸15を中心にレバー式の挟持部材16の基端側を押し込んで先端側を起こすことにより紐状部材3に対するカム面16aの押し付けを解除することができる。こうして、紐状部材3の長さを容易かつ確実に長短調節することができる。   The locking member 5 may be anything as long as the free end side of the string-like member 3 is hooked on one handle 4 and then locked at a predetermined position. As shown in FIG. 5, the locking device 5 includes a base frame portion 14 having side wall portions 14 </ b> A and 14 </ b> A opposed to each other by a first pin body P <b> 1 and a second pin body P <b> 2 arranged in the front-rear direction, and the side wall portion. 14A and 14A is pivotably mounted by a rotating shaft 15 approximately in the middle, and a cam surface 16a is provided on the peripheral surface on the tip side, and a torsion spring 17 wound around the rotating shaft 15 is provided. And a lever-type clamping member 16 that is always urged in the closing direction A. And the free end side of the said string-like member 3 to which the one end 3a was fixed and the middle was fixed to the said 1st pin body P1 was hung around the said handle | steering-wheel 4, the said cam 16a surface, and said 2nd The cam surface 16a and the second pin of the pinching member 16 that is constantly biased in the closing direction a by the biasing force of the torsion spring 17 by inserting a pinching force between the pin body P2 and applying a tightening force. The string-like member 3 is clamped by the body P2 and is locked by the locking tool 5. Further, the pushing of the cam surface 16a against the cord-like member 3 is released by pushing the proximal end side of the lever-type clamping member 16 around the rotation shaft 15 against the urging force of the torsion spring 17 and raising the distal end side. can do. Thus, the length of the string-like member 3 can be adjusted easily and reliably.

前記紐状部材3が、紐、または図示する本実施形態のようにベルト18、ロープの何れかである。   The string-like member 3 is either a string or a belt 18 or a rope as in the illustrated embodiment.

前記床面2が、パレット19である。このパレット19は、例えば図1に示すように1つのパレット19毎に所望台数、本実施形態では1個のパレット19毎に4台の駐輪が行え、1つのパレット19が満杯になると、満車になったパレット19と、空きパレット19′とを交換移動させることにより、バイクBを立体駐車させることができるものである。パレット19の上下方向Z、または前後方向Y、もしくは左右方向Xの移動は、図には示さないが、駆動源としてモータ、スプロケット、チェーン等を用いた公知形式のものと同様であるので、詳細は省略する。   The floor surface 2 is a pallet 19. For example, as shown in FIG. 1, the number of pallets 19 can be set to a desired number for each pallet 19, and in this embodiment, four pallets can be parked for each pallet 19. When one pallet 19 is full, By exchanging and moving the pallet 19 and the empty pallet 19 ', the motorcycle B can be three-dimensionally parked. The movement of the pallet 19 in the up-down direction Z, the front-rear direction Y, or the left-right direction X is not shown in the drawing, but is the same as that of a known type using a motor, sprocket, chain, or the like as a drive source. 本実施形態のバイク用立体駐車場の実施形態は以上の構成からなり、バイクBのハンドル4を転倒防止装置6に固定するのには、先ず、バイクBを立体駐車場の床面2、本実施形態ではパレット19に前進し、スタンドSにて支持する。   The embodiment of the three-dimensional parking lot for motorcycles according to this embodiment has the above-described configuration. First, to fix the handle 4 of the motorcycle B to the overturn prevention device 6, first, attach the motorcycle B to the floor 2 of the multilevel parking lot, the book In the embodiment, the pallet 19 moves forward and is supported by the stand S.

これには、例えば図1、図6に示すように、図示しないスプリングばねの附勢力に抗してバイクBの一側下部に設けたサイド式スタンドS1を起こし、前輪20Aを平面視における中立姿勢位置Nよりも角度θに傾けた状態にて前輪20Aと、サイド式スタンドS1と、後輪20Bとの3個所にてバイクBを床面2上に図において左側に傾けて支持する。   For example, as shown in FIGS. 1 and 6, a side stand S1 provided on one lower side of the motorcycle B is raised against a biasing force of a spring spring (not shown), and the front wheel 20A is in a neutral position in plan view. The motorcycle B is tilted and supported on the floor surface 2 on the left side in the drawing at three locations of the front wheel 20A, the side stand S1, and the rear wheel 20B in a state inclined at an angle θ from the position N.

次いで、床面2上に設けられた支持棒1の先端に一端3aが取付けられた紐状部材3を把持し、前後左右上下の何れの方向にも移動されるという自由度を発揮する紐状部材3の他端側の先端部3bに設けられている係止具5によりバイクBの傾けられた一側のハンドル4を係止する。   Next, a string-like shape that exhibits a degree of freedom in which the string-like member 3 having one end 3a attached to the tip of the support bar 1 provided on the floor surface 2 is grasped and moved in any of the front, rear, left, right, up and down directions. The handle 4 on the inclined side of the motorcycle B is locked by a locking tool 5 provided at the tip 3b on the other end side of the member 3.

この際、本実施形態では、図2乃至図4に示すように、バイクBに対して左側に設けた転倒防止柵7Bの横柵8,8に前後方向Yに摺動可能に外嵌された案内枠体9,9′と、該案内枠体9を横柵8の所望位置に取り付ける止めボルト10A、およびナット10Bと、前記案内枠体9,9′の外側に縦に固着される支持外筒体11と、該支持外筒体11内に上下方向Zに摺動自在に挿入される前記支持棒1と、該支持棒1を前記支持外筒体11の所望位置に取り付けるセットピン12、および該セットピン12の雄ねじ部12aに螺合される雌ねじ孔13aを有する操作ノブ13とにより形成されているので、止めボルト10Aをナット10Bから螺退し、緩めることにより、転倒防止柵7Bの横柵8,8に外嵌された案内枠体9,9′を前後方向Yに摺動させて支持棒1の取付け位置を調整しておく。また、操作ノブ13を回動操作して雌ねじ孔13aからセットピン12の雄ねじ部12aの螺合を解くことにより、支持外筒体11内に挿入されている支持棒1を上下方向Zに摺動し、取付け高さを調整させておく。   At this time, in this embodiment, as shown in FIGS. 2 to 4, the bike B is externally fitted to the lateral fences 8, 8 of the fall prevention fence 7 </ b> B provided on the left side so as to be slidable in the front-rear direction Y. A guide frame body 9, 9 ', a set bolt 10A for attaching the guide frame body 9 to a desired position of the horizontal fence 8, and a nut 10B, and a support outside which is vertically fixed to the outside of the guide frame body 9, 9'. A cylindrical body 11, the support rod 1 slidably inserted in the vertical direction Z into the support outer cylinder 11, and a set pin 12 for attaching the support rod 1 to a desired position of the support outer cylinder 11. And the operation knob 13 having the female screw hole 13a screwed into the male screw portion 12a of the set pin 12, the set bolt 10A is screwed out of the nut 10B and loosened to thereby loosen the fall prevention fence 7B. The guide frames 9, 9 'fitted on the side fences 8, 8 are moved in the front-rear direction. Keep adjusting the mounting position of the support bar 1 is slid on. Further, the support knob 1 inserted in the support outer cylinder 11 is slid in the vertical direction Z by rotating the operation knob 13 to unscrew the male screw portion 12a of the set pin 12 from the female screw hole 13a. Move and adjust the mounting height.

そして、支持棒1の先端に一端3aが取付けられた紐状部材3を把持し、この紐状部材3の他端側の先端部3bに設けられている係止具5によりバイクBの傾けられた一側のハンドル4を係止するが、紐状部材3は、本実施形態ではベルト18を1本用いて一側のハンドル4を係止しているので、ベルト18は前後左右上下の何れの方向にも移動されて自由度を発揮するため、係止具5に対してハンドル4を迅速かつ確実に位置合わせが行われ、一側のハンドル4を係止することができる。   Then, the cord-like member 3 having one end 3a attached to the tip of the support rod 1 is gripped, and the motorcycle B is tilted by a locking tool 5 provided at the tip portion 3b on the other end side of the cord-like member 3. In this embodiment, the string-like member 3 uses one belt 18 to lock the handle 4 on one side. Therefore, the handle 4 can be quickly and reliably aligned with the locking tool 5 and the handle 4 on one side can be locked.

そして、前記係止具5が、紐状部材3の自由端側が一方のハンドル4に掛け回された後に所定位置にて係止されるものであれば如何様なものでも良いが、本実施形態では例えば図5に示すように、前記係止具5が、前後に配する第1ピン体P1、および第2ピン体P2により対向された側壁部14A,14Aを有する基枠部14と、前記側壁部14A,14A間の略中程に回動軸15により起倒可能に枢着され、先端側の周面にはカム面16aが設けられ、前記回動軸15に捲回されたねじりばね17により常時、閉方向イに附勢されているレバー式の挟持部材16と、により構成されるので、一端3aが固定されるとともに中途が前記第1ピン体P1に止着された前記紐状部材3の自由端側を、前記ハンドル4に掛け回し、それから、前記カム16a面と、前記第2ピン体P2との間に挿通して引き締め力を加えることにより、常時、ねじりばね17の附勢力により閉方向イに附勢されている挟持部材16の前記カム面16aと第2ピン体P2とにより紐状部材3は挟持され、係止具5にて紐状部材3は係止される。また、ねじりばね17の附勢力に抗して回動軸15を中心にレバー式の挟持部材16の基端側を押し込んで先端側を起こすことにより紐状部材3に対するカム面16aの押し付けを解除し、紐状部材3を緩めることができる。こうして、紐状部材3の長さを容易かつ確実に長短調節することができ、一側のハンドル4を係止している係止具5を一端に設けている紐状部材3としてのベルト18に、余計な弛みをなくし、丁度良い、張りを持たせてバイクBを支持する。   The locking device 5 may be anything as long as the free end side of the string-like member 3 is hooked on one handle 4 and locked at a predetermined position. Then, for example, as shown in FIG. 5, the locking member 5 includes a base frame portion 14 having side wall portions 14 </ b> A and 14 </ b> A that are opposed to each other by a first pin body P <b> 1 and a second pin body P <b> 2 arranged in the front and rear directions, A torsion spring that is pivotably mounted by a rotating shaft 15 approximately in the middle between the side wall portions 14A and 14A, a cam surface 16a is provided on the peripheral surface on the distal end side, and is wound around the rotating shaft 15. 17 and the lever-type pinching member 16 that is constantly urged in the closing direction A, so that the one end 3a is fixed and the middle is fixed to the first pin body P1. The free end side of the member 3 is hung around the handle 4, and then the cap The cam surface 16a of the clamping member 16 that is constantly urged in the closing direction A by the urging force of the torsion spring 17 by inserting between the surface 16a and the second pin body P2 and applying a tightening force. And the second pin body P <b> 2 hold the string-like member 3, and the string-like member 3 is locked by the locking tool 5. Further, the pushing of the cam surface 16a against the cord-like member 3 is released by pushing the proximal end side of the lever-type clamping member 16 around the rotation shaft 15 against the urging force of the torsion spring 17 and raising the distal end side. Then, the string-like member 3 can be loosened. In this way, the length of the string-like member 3 can be adjusted easily and reliably, and the belt 18 as the string-like member 3 provided with the locking tool 5 that holds the handle 4 on one side is provided at one end. In addition, it eliminates excessive slack and supports the motorcycle B with just good tension.

上記手順、および上記操作を繰り返して行うようにして、図1に示すように1つのパレット19毎に所望台数、本実施形態では1個のパレット19毎に4台の駐輪を行う。そして、1つのパレット19が満杯になると、満車になったパレット19と、空きパレット19′とを交換移動させることにより、バイクBを立体駐車させる。この際、パレット19の上下方向Z、または前後方向Y、もしくは左右方向Xの移動は、駆動源としてモータ、スプロケット、チェーン等を用いた公知形式のものが使用されるので、詳細な説明は省略する。   By repeating the above procedure and the above operations, as shown in FIG. 1, a desired number of vehicles are parked for each pallet 19, and in this embodiment, four bicycles are parked for each pallet 19. When one pallet 19 is full, the full pallet 19 and the empty pallet 19 'are exchanged to move the motorcycle B in a three-dimensional park. At this time, the movement of the pallet 19 in the up-down direction Z, the front-rear direction Y, or the left-right direction X is a well-known type using a motor, a sprocket, a chain, or the like as a drive source. To do.

そして、本実施形態では、例えば図1、図6に示すように、図示しないスプリングばねの附勢力に抗してバイクBの一側下部に起こされたサイド式スタンドS1と、平面視における中立姿勢位置Nよりも角度θに傾けられた前輪20Aと、後輪20Bとの3個所にて床面としてのパレット19上に図において左側に傾けられてバイクBは支持されるのと、その一側、図1、図6においては左側のハンドル4が、前述のように、係止具5により、紐状部材3としての1本のベルト18を介して支持棒1に支持されているのとから、安定性が増し、上下前後左右の何れの方向から地震等の外力が加わっても紐状部材3が上下前後左右の何れの方向から自由度をもって引っ張りが働くことによりバイクBは不用意に転倒されるのが確実に防止される。   In this embodiment, for example, as shown in FIGS. 1 and 6, a side stand S <b> 1 raised at one side lower part of the motorcycle B against a biasing force of a spring spring (not shown), and a neutral posture in plan view The bike B is supported by being tilted to the left in the drawing on the pallet 19 as a floor surface at the three positions of the front wheel 20A and the rear wheel 20B inclined from the position N by the angle θ. 1 and 6, the left handle 4 is supported by the support rod 1 by the locking member 5 via the single belt 18 as the string-like member 3 as described above. Because of increased stability, even if an external force such as an earthquake is applied from any direction (up / down / front / left / right), the string-like member 3 pulls freely with any degree of freedom / up / down / left / right, and the motorcycle B falls down carelessly. Is definitely prevented

また、少なくともバイクBの前部、および左右の両側には、前記バイクBを囲むように、転倒防止柵7A,7B,7B′が設けられ、左右の両側の前記転倒防止柵7B,7B′相互間の略1/2の設置幅Wが、バイクBの中立姿勢におけるハンドル4,4の設置高さhに相当する長さLよりも短く形成されているので、スタンドSにて支持されるバイクBは、床面2に対し上下前後に移動可能に設けられた支持棒1の先端に一端3aが取付けられた紐状部材3としてのベルト18の他端側の先端部3bに設けられた係止具5により紐状部材3を介して一側のハンドル4が係止され、スタンドSにて支持されているバイクBは地震等による外力を受けた場合に、仮にベルト18が切断されてもバイクBの前部、および左右の両側に、前記バイクBを囲むように、設けた転倒防止柵7A,7B,7B′により転倒するのが防止され、高い安全性を発揮する。   Further, at least the front part of the motorcycle B and the left and right sides are provided with fall prevention fences 7A, 7B, 7B 'so as to surround the bike B, and the fall prevention fences 7B, 7B' on both the left and right sides are mutually connected. The motorcycle supported by the stand S because the installation width W of about ½ is shorter than the length L corresponding to the installation height h of the handles 4 and 4 in the neutral posture of the motorcycle B. B is an engagement provided at the tip 3b on the other end side of the belt 18 as a string-like member 3 having one end 3a attached to the tip of the support rod 1 provided to be movable up and down with respect to the floor 2. Even if the handle B on one side is locked by the stopper 5 via the string-like member 3 and the motorcycle B supported by the stand S receives an external force due to an earthquake or the like, even if the belt 18 is cut off, The bike B is enclosed on the front of the bike B and on both the left and right sides. As such, fall prevention fence 7A provided, 7B, to fall by 7B 'is prevented, it exhibits high safety.
